    Let me share an interview experience I had with a foreign employer recently.

    It was a job in my field but different from my previous job description. It is like I was shooting rifles, and here I was applying for a position shooting pistols. But still the same shooting and hitting targets. (analogy ra na ha, I dont shoot in real life, hehe)

    The guy explained, most employers nowadays, rarely give chances for people wanting to change fields of work. With tight budgets, less is alloted for training these people. Most if not all companies want people who can hit the ground running so to speak.

    For those who are able to shift fields of occupation and are successful, consider yourselves lucky and fortunate. You have a kind employer who sees your worth beyond that paper called a resume.

    Otherwise, life is a dead end, you are stuck with what you have and live with it.
